It is the last league game in the Caribbean Premier League 2024. Table toppers and defending champions Guyana Amazon Warriors would take Trinbago Knight Riders in the 30th game. The Guyana Amazon Warriors defeated the Saint Lucia Kings in the last game. The Trinbago Knight Riders defeated the Barbados Royals in their last game, and they will be confident heading into the contest.
The Guyana Amazon Warriors have won four games in a row and it will make the team confident. They had lost to the Knight Riders in the earlier game this season and the players would look to settle scores. The Knight Riders have a strong batting lineup and we expect a cracker of a contest.

Imran Tahir and his men put up a great show against the Saint Lucia Kings in the last game, winning by 35 runs. It was a clinical performance from their batsmen and bowlers that has taken them to the top of the points table. They have won all home games and shall look to keep this unblemished record.
Azam Khan and Rahmanullah Gurbaz have shown good form in the last few games and the team expects a good start from them. Shai Hope, Shimron Hetmyer, and Romario Shepherd made runs in the last game and add strength to the batting lineup in the middle order. The team will also expect runs from Keemo Paul and Moeen Ali down the order.
The bowling attack will be up against a big challenge in this game and expects a good show from Gudakesh Motie and Dwaine Pretorius with the new ball. Moeen Ali and Imran Tahir have a lot of experience and need to do well. Keemo Paul, Shepherd, and Junior Sinclair add strength to this bowling attack.

Kieron Pollard's team defeated the Barbados Royals in the last game by 30 runs. The team is through to the playoffs and they will look to finish within the Top 2 on the points table with a big win. They defeated the Guyana Amazon Warriors earlier in the season and Pollard and his men would like to take inspiration from that win.
Jason Roy will look to deliver a good start with Sunil Narine as the opening pair hasn’t been consistent. Nicholas Pooran is the backbone of this batting lineup and must build partnerships with Keacy Carty and Pollard. The team will also expect runs in the lower middle order from Andre Russell, Tim David, and Chris Jordan as all of them are good hitters.
Akeal Hosein is in form and bowled brilliantly in the last game. The team expects early strikes from him and Tim David. Waqar Salamkheil has troubled the batters and he must bowl right spells in the middle order with Sunil Narine. Terrance Hinds, Pollard, and Chris Jordan strengthen this attack.

Providence Stadium, Guyana, is one of the best T20 pitches in the Caribbean islands. It is good for the bowlers and batters. On this surface, fast bowlers can generate pace and swing the ball. The shorter boundaries make it easy for the batsmen. Spinners also do well in the second half of the game.
In the six games played at this venue this season, the side batting first has defended the score successfully on five occasions. The wicket is slowing down in the second innings. The two teams would look at these results and prefer batting first on winning the toss.
